Trensacq is a region located within the Landes department of Nouvelle-Aquitaine, France, known for its extensive pine forests and the tranquil Leyre River. The landscape is defined by vast forest massifs, sandy trails, and the river's gallery forest, all contributing to a preserved natural environment. This setting provides a suitable backdrop for outdoor pursuits, including several sports like touring cycling and jogging.

Trensacq is characterized by its extensive pine forests and the tranquil Leyre River. The Leyre flows through a gallery forest, forming part of the Landes de Gascogne Regional Natural Park. These features contribute to a preserved natural environment ideal for outdoor exploration.

The Landes de Gascogne Regional Natural Park is a vast natural park where Trensacq is located. It is one of the largest forest massifs in Western Europe, covering almost a million hectares. The park offers numerous trails for various outdoor activities.

Trensacq features a well-equipped picnic area located within an oak grove north of the town hall. This spot offers a peaceful setting for relaxation after outdoor activities.
